Baroness Merron (Lab)

Speaking in the House of Lords on 25 June 2026

Debate

Puberty Blockers Trial: Consent

Contribution

My noble friend is quite right about the use of these drugs. It is important to note that we banned their use indefinitely for gender dysphoria outside of research settings because of the immense concerns about safety. That ban has been in place since January 2025. She is also right that the issue will not go away. The right way to protect children, as I have said, is to act on clinical evidence and opinion, and to make that decision with a cool head. That is why, despite the difficulty of such a decision, the Secretary of State has made it. He is doing the best he can to protect children in this situation.
